What is the difference between the food habits of organisms belonging to the first and the third trophic levels? Give one example each of the organisms belonging to these two trophic levels.

उत्तर
| First trophic level | Third trophic level |
| Producers belong to the first trophic level. | Carnivores belong to the third trophic level. |
| They prepare their own food by photosynthesis. | They consume the flesh of other animals. |
| Example: Green plants. |
Example: Lions.
